Dutch Lap Siding Installation Questions
What is Dutch Lap Siding? Dutch Lap siding is a type of exterior cladding characterized by overlapping horizontal boards with a distinctive beveled edge, offering a traditional and appealing look for homes.
What are common materials used for Dutch Lap Siding? It is often made from wood, vinyl, or fiber cement, providing options for different budgets and maintenance preferences.
Can Dutch Lap Siding be installed on existing walls? Yes, it can be added over existing siding or directly onto the wall surface, depending on the condition and structure of the property.
What maintenance is required for Dutch Lap Siding? Regular cleaning and inspection for damage help maintain its appearance and longevity, with some materials requiring periodic repainting or sealing.
